Jim Cramer, the host of CNBC’s “Mad Money,” recently turned his attention to Arm Holdings (NASDAQ: ARM), the British semiconductor and software design company. During his show, Cramer addressed what he characterized as a “silly” element surrounding the stock. While the exact nature of his comment was not fully detailed in available reports, such remarks often center on market overreactions or inconsistencies in investor sentiment. Arm Holdings has been a high-profile stock since its initial public offering in September 2023, with its share price experiencing volatility amid the broader AI-driven rally. The company’s technology is foundational for many mobile devices and increasingly for AI chips, which has fueled both optimism and skepticism among analysts. Cramer’s commentary adds to the ongoing discussion about whether Arm’s current market valuation adequately reflects its long-term potential or if speculative factors have inflated expectations. Key takeaways from Cramer’s discussion suggest that investors may be focusing on certain narratives that do not align with fundamental realities. The “silly” thing could refer to the hype surrounding Arm’s exposure to AI without considering its actual revenue contributions from that sector. Arm generates most of its revenue from licensing its chip architecture, which is used in billions of devices, but its direct AI revenue stream may still be evolving. Additionally, the stock’s price-to-earnings ratio has been elevated compared to other semiconductor peers, leading to debates about sustainability. Market participants might need to consider that while Arm’s technology is crucial, its financial performance may not immediately reflect the AI boom. Any moves in the stock could be influenced by broader market sentiment rather than near-term earnings growth. From an investment perspective, Jim Cramer’s remarks serve as a reminder to approach high-growth tech stocks with caution. While Arm Holdings holds a strategic position in the semiconductor ecosystem, its valuation may be subject to re-evaluation as market conditions change. Investors might benefit from focusing on company fundamentals such as licensing agreements, royalty rates, and expansion into new markets like automotive and data centers. The broader implications suggest that even for companies with strong technological moats, stock prices can deviate from intrinsic value in the short term. Any decision to invest in Arm should be based on individual research and risk tolerance, as the semiconductor industry is cyclical and competitive. Future earnings reports and guidance will likely provide more clarity on the company’s trajectory.
